I would not unless it was a concrete pad. Rule #1 is do not build up to level, dig down onto solid ground. I have seen retaining walls collpase over years due to erosion, poorly constructed, heavy rains, ground shifting, etc. At least a concrete pad would reinforce it.
Saying that however, if the pad was several years old, and heavily compacted that may be a different story.
